Customization Options Offered by a Professional Soundproof Door Factory

A professional soundproof door factory offers a wide range of customization options to meet the varying needs of different environments. From residential properties to commercial studios and industrial facilities, soundproof doors serve a crucial function in controlling noise and improving acoustic privacy. Every space may require a different combination of features, and a soundproof door factory can tailor its products accordingly to meet these specific demands.

One of the primary customization options available from a soundproof door factory is size and shape. Unlike standard doors, soundproof doors are often needed in unconventional dimensions due to architectural or design constraints. Whether for extra-tall entryways, wide loading areas, or unusual structural openings, a soundproof door factory can produce doors that match exact measurements. Custom sizing ensures that the door fits properly, which is essential for both sound isolation and structural integrity.

Another key option is the core material used in the door's construction. The core plays a central role in how effectively a door blocks or absorbs sound. A soundproof door factory typically offers a variety of core materials such as solid wood, metal sheets, gypsum, or mineral wool. Some applications may require a denser core for increased mass, while others might benefit from a combination of mass and sound-absorbing layers. Choosing the appropriate core material ensures that the door meets the desired level of sound performance.

A professional soundproof door factory also provides customization for door finishes and surface materials. Depending on the setting, different finishes may be required to match existing décor, provide durability, or meet hygiene standards. Common finish options include wood veneers, painted steel, powder coating, and laminate surfaces. In a commercial or public space, a scratch-resistant or easy-to-clean surface might be preferred, while a private residence may call for a decorative wood finish. These choices allow customers to balance function with design.

Another important customization feature offered by a soundproof door factory is the selection of sealing systems. To be effective, a soundproof door must prevent air gaps around its edges. Factories often install high-quality acoustic seals, drop-down bottom seals, and automatic threshold systems. These sealing elements reduce the transmission of airborne sound and improve the overall performance of the door. Depending on the environment, different levels of acoustic sealing can be specified, and adjustments can be made for mobility access or temperature control needs.

Glass inserts are also available as part of the customization process. While glass typically presents a challenge in soundproofing, a soundproof door factory can use special laminated or multi-layer acoustic glass that limits noise transfer while still allowing visibility. Glass options can vary in shape, size, and placement depending on privacy requirements, safety regulations, or lighting preferences. Even with glass, soundproof performance can be preserved when proper materials and installation methods are applied.

Hardware selection is another area of customization provided by a soundproof door factory. The choice of hinges, locks, handles, and closers can be adapted to suit both functional and aesthetic needs. Some projects may require heavy-duty hardware for high-traffic areas, while others may prioritize silent operation or concealed fixtures. A soundproof door factory ensures that all hardware components are compatible with the acoustic design and provide reliable use over time.

A professional soundproof door factory offers a wide range of customization options to meet the acoustic, structural, and aesthetic requirements of different environments. Custom sizing, core materials, finishes, sealing systems, glass options, and hardware choices all contribute to creating a door that fits the project’s specific needs. By working with a soundproof door factory that understands these variables, customers can achieve improved noise control and a better-quality space suited to their unique application.
